 Bill Status of HB0660  96th General Assembly


Short Description:  $DHS-RAISE DD AGNCY STAFF WAGE

Synopsis As Introduced
Appropriates $45,000,000 from the General Revenue Fund to the Department of Human Services to fund a $0.50-per-hour wage increase for non-executive staff of private-sector agencies serving individuals with developmental disabilities. Effective July 1, 2009.
